WebDec 16, 2024 · chrony provides support to work out the gain or loss rate of the real-time clock, i.e. the clock that maintains the time when the computer is turned off. It can use this data when the system boots to set the system time from a corrected version of the real-time clock. These real-time clock facilities are only available on Linux, so far. WebMay 23, 2024 · Using --set option, hwclock set the Hardware Clock to the time given by the –date option, and update the timestamps in /etc/adjtime. sudo hwclock --set --date ' 05/21/2024 19:15:19 '. After setting the hardware clock, we will need to update the system clock from it with sudo hwclock --hctosys command; sudo hwclock --hctosys. WebTo install chrony, run the following command from a terminal prompt: sudo apt install chrony This will provide two binaries: chronyd - the actual daemon to sync and serve via the Network Time Protocol chronyc - command-line interface for chrony daemon Configure chronyd Firstly, edit /etc/chrony/chrony.conf to add/remove server lines.
